add support for previewing pages
This commit is contained in:
+7
-1
@@ -3,8 +3,14 @@ import { CodegenConfig } from "@graphql-codegen/cli";
|
||||
import { loadEnvConfig } from "@next/env";
|
||||
loadEnvConfig(process.cwd());
|
||||
|
||||
const wagtailBaseUrl = process.env.WAGTAIL_BASE_URL;
|
||||
if (!wagtailBaseUrl) {
|
||||
throw new Error("WAGTAIL_BASE_URL is not set");
|
||||
}
|
||||
const graphqlEndpoint = `${wagtailBaseUrl.replace(/\/$/, "")}/api/graphql/`;
|
||||
|
||||
const config: CodegenConfig = {
|
||||
schema: process.env.GRAPHQL_ENDPOINT,
|
||||
schema: graphqlEndpoint,
|
||||
documents: ["src/**/*.tsx", "src/**/*.ts"],
|
||||
ignoreNoDocuments: true, // for better experience with the watcher
|
||||
generates: {
|
||||
|
||||
Reference in New Issue
Block a user